*{-webkit-box-sizing:border-box;box-sizing:border-box}html{height:100%}body{padding:0;margin:0;height:100%;width:100%;font-family:"Arial", sans-serif;font-size:16px;max-width:100%;color:#581d28}a{color:#581d28;text-decoration:none}.main-content{position:relative;z-index:0;padding-top:10em;max-width:1440px;margin:0 auto}ul li{font-size:1.2em;padding-bottom:.5em}h1{font-size:2em}h3{color:#581d28;margin-bottom:0}h2{color:#323232;margin-top:0}p{margin-top:0px;margin-bottom:1em;font-size:1.2em;line-height:1.6}header{position:fixed;top:0px;left:0px;width:100%;height:10em;background:#fff;z-index:10}header .logo{position:absolute;left:5%;top:2em}header .logo img{display:block;width:150px;height:auto}header .menutrigger{position:absolute;right:10%;top:4em}header .menutrigger span{display:block;width:2em;height:4px;background:#000;margin:.5em 0em}body nav{position:fixed;top:0px;left:0px;width:100%;height:100%;-webkit-transition:-webkit-transform .5s;transition:-webkit-transform .5s;-o-transition:transform .5s;transition:transform .5s;transition:transform .5s, -webkit-transform .5s;z-index:99;pointer-events:none}body nav a.close-menu{position:fixed;width:100%;height:100%;background:rgba(0,0,0,0);pointer-events:none;-webkit-transition:background .5s;-o-transition:background .5s;transition:background .5s}body nav ul{display:block;width:100%;height:100%;margin:0px;padding:2em;-webkit-transform:translate3d(100%, 0, 0);transform:translate3d(100%, 0, 0);-webkit-transition:-webkit-transform .5s;transition:-webkit-transform .5s;-o-transition:transform .5s;transition:transform .5s;transition:transform .5s, -webkit-transform .5s;background:#fff}body nav ul li{display:block;padding-right:20%;padding-bottom:1em}body nav ul li.desktop-logo{display:none}body nav ul li a{font-size:2em}body.menuopen nav{pointer-events:auto}body.menuopen nav a.close-menu{background:rgba(0,0,0,0.8);pointer-events:auto}body.menuopen nav ul{-webkit-transform:translate3d(20%, 0, 0);transform:translate3d(20%, 0, 0)}.content .image-section{display:block;width:100%;position:relative;overflow:hidden;z-index:0;color:#fff}.content .image-section .background{background-size:cover;background-position:center center;position:absolute;-webkit-transform:scale(1.4);-ms-transform:scale(1.4);transform:scale(1.4);-webkit-transition:-webkit-transform 3s;transition:-webkit-transform 3s;-o-transition:transform 3s;transition:transform 3s;transition:transform 3s, -webkit-transform 3s;top:0px;left:0px;width:100%;height:100%;z-index:0}.content .image-section .foreground{position:relative;z-index:1;padding:15em 5% 2em 5%}.content.visible .image-section .background{-webkit-transform:scale(1);-ms-transform:scale(1);transform:scale(1)}footer{background:#581d28;color:#fff;padding:5%;text-align:center}footer .two-cols .col{text-align:left}footer ul.meta-menu{margin:0;padding:0}footer ul.meta-menu li{display:inline-block;width:auto;margin-right:1em}footer ul.meta-menu li a{color:#fff}.two-cols .col{padding:1em 5%}.one-col{padding:1em 5%}.owl-carousel .animated{-webkit-animation-duration:3000ms;animation-duration:3000ms;-webkit-animation-fill-mode:both;animation-fill-mode:both}.owl-carousel .owl-animated-in{z-index:0}.owl-carousel .owl-animated-out{z-index:1}.owl-carousel .fadeOut{-webkit-animation-name:fadeOut;animation-name:fadeOut}@-webkit-keyframes fadeOut{0%{opacity:1}100%{opacity:0}}@keyframes fadeOut{0%{opacity:1}100%{opacity:0}}.owl-height{-webkit-transition:height 500ms ease-in-out;-o-transition:height 500ms ease-in-out;transition:height 500ms ease-in-out}.owl-carousel{display:none;width:100%;-webkit-tap-highlight-color:transparent;position:relative;z-index:1}.owl-carousel .owl-stage{position:relative;-ms-touch-action:pan-Y}.owl-carousel .owl-stage:after{content:".";display:block;clear:both;visibility:hidden;line-height:0;height:0}.owl-carousel .owl-stage-outer{position:relative;overflow:hidden;-webkit-transform:translate3d(0px, 0px, 0px)}.owl-carousel .owl-controls .owl-nav .owl-prev,.owl-carousel .owl-controls .owl-nav .owl-next,.owl-carousel .owl-controls .owl-dot{cursor:pointer;cursor:hand;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.owl-carousel.owl-loaded{display:block}.owl-carousel.owl-loading{opacity:0;display:block}.owl-carousel.owl-hidden{opacity:0}.owl-carousel .owl-refresh .owl-item{display:none}.owl-carousel .owl-item{position:relative;min-height:1px;float:left;-webkit-tap-highlight-color:transparent;-webkit-touch-callout: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.owl-carousel .owl-item img{display:block;width:100%;-webkit-transform-style:preserve-3d}.owl-carousel.owl-text-select-on .owl-item{-webkit-user-select:auto;-moz-user-select:auto;-ms-user-select:auto;user-select:auto}.owl-carousel .owl-grab{cursor:move;cursor:-webkit-grab;cursor:-o-grab;cursor:-ms-grab;cursor:grab}.owl-carousel.owl-rtl{direction:rtl}.owl-carousel.owl-rtl .owl-item{float:right}.no-js .owl-carousel{display:block}.owl-carousel .owl-item .owl-lazy{opacity:0;-webkit-transition:opacity 400ms ease;-o-transition:opacity 400ms ease;transition:opacity 400ms ease}.owl-carousel .owl-item img{-webkit-transform-style:preserve-3d;transform-style:preserve-3d}.owl-carousel .owl-video-wrapper{position:relative;height:100%;background:#000}.owl-carousel .owl-video-play-icon{position:absolute;height:80px;width:80px;left:50%;top:50%;margin-left:-40px;margin-top:-40px;background:url("owl.video.play.png") no-repeat;cursor:pointer;z-index:1;-webkit-transition:scale 100ms ease;-o-transition:scale 100ms ease;transition:scale 100ms ease}.owl-carousel .owl-video-play-icon:hover{-webkit-transition:scale(1.3, 1.3);-o-transition:scale(1.3, 1.3);transition:scale(1.3, 1.3)}.owl-carousel .owl-video-playing .owl-video-tn,.owl-carousel .owl-video-playing .owl-video-play-icon{display:none}.owl-carousel .owl-video-tn{opacity:0;height:100%;background-position:center center;background-repeat:no-repeat;background-size:contain;-webkit-transition:opacity 400ms ease;-o-transition:opacity 400ms ease;transition:opacity 400ms ease}.owl-carousel .owl-video-frame{position:relative;z-index:1}.button-container{display:block;margin-bottom:2em}.button-container.center{text-align:center}.button-container a.btn{display:inline-block;padding:1em 2em;color:#fff;background:#581d28}.product-item{padding:.5em;margin-left:-.5em}.product-slider{margin-bottom:3em}.product-slider .owl-controls{display:none}.product-slider .caption{padding:0 1em}.text-and-image{display:block;overflow:hidden;padding:0 5%;margin-bottom:3em}.text-and-image .mobile-image{display:block;width:100%;height:auto}.text-and-image.cover .image-wrapper .image-container{background-size:cover;background-position:center center}.text-and-image .image-wrapper{width:100%;height:auto;overflow:hidden;position:relative;display:none}.text-and-image .image-wrapper .image-container{display:block;height:500px;background-size:contain;background-position:center bottom;background-repeat:no-repeat}.text-and-image .image-wrapper .image-container .image-link{display:block;background:rgba(0,0,0,0);-webkit-transition:background .5s;-o-transition:background .5s;transition:background .5s;width:100%;height:100%}.text-and-image .image-wrapper .image-container .image-link .image-holder{-webkit-transform:scale(1.5);-ms-transform:scale(1.5);transform:scale(1.5);-webkit-transition:opacity .5s, -webkit-transform .5s;transition:opacity .5s, -webkit-transform .5s;-o-transition:opacity .5s, transform .5s;transition:opacity .5s, transform .5s;transition:opacity .5s, transform .5s, -webkit-transform .5s}.text-and-image .image-wrapper .image-container .image-link:hover{background:rgba(0,0,0,0);-webkit-transition-delay:0s;-o-transition-delay:0s;transition-delay:0s}.text-and-image .image-wrapper .image-container .image-link:hover .image-holder{opacity:1;-webkit-transition-delay:0s;-o-transition-delay:0s;transition-delay:0s;-webkit-transform:scale(1.5);-ms-transform:scale(1.5);transform:scale(1.5)}.text-and-image .text-wrapper{display:block;padding:1em 0em 2em 0;text-align:left}.content-wrapper .text-and-image .image-wrapper{opacity:0}.content-wrapper .text-and-image.text-left .text-wrapper{-webkit-transform:translate3d(-20%, 0, 0);transform:translate3d(-20%, 0, 0);-webkit-transition:-webkit-transform 3s;transition:-webkit-transform 3s;-o-transition:transform 3s;transition:transform 3s;transition:transform 3s, -webkit-transform 3s}.content-wrapper .text-and-image.text-right .text-wrapper{-webkit-transform:translate3d(20%, 0, 0);transform:translate3d(20%, 0, 0);-webkit-transition:-webkit-transform 3s;transition:-webkit-transform 3s;-o-transition:transform 3s;transition:transform 3s;transition:transform 3s, -webkit-transform 3s}@media all and (min-width: 600px){header .logo{display:none}header .menutrigger{display:none}body nav{position:fixed;top:0px;left:0px;width:100%;height:100px;-webkit-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0);z-index:20;pointer-events:auto}body nav .close-menu{display:none}body nav ul{display:block;width:100%;margin:0;text-align:center;-webkit-transform:translate3d(0, 0, 0);transform:translate3d(0, 0, 0);padding:2em 0}body nav ul li{display:inline-block;vertical-align:middle;width:auto;padding:0 1em;line-height:100px}body nav ul li a{font-size:1em}body nav ul li.desktop-logo{display:inline-block}body nav ul li img{display:block;height:100px;width:auto}body nav ul li a{display:block;height:100px;line-height:100px;position:relative}body nav ul li a:after{position:absolute;bottom:1.5em;content:"";width:50%;height:5px;background:#581d28;left:50%;opacity:0;-webkit-transform:translate3d(-50%, 0, 0) scaleX(0);transform:translate3d(-50%, 0, 0) scaleX(0);-webkit-transition:opacity .5s, -webkit-transform .5s;transition:opacity .5s, -webkit-transform .5s;-o-transition:opacity .5s, transform .5s;transition:opacity .5s, transform .5s;transition:opacity .5s, transform .5s, -webkit-transform .5s}body nav ul li a.current:after{opacity:1;-webkit-transform:translate3d(-50%, 0, 0) scaleX(1);transform:translate3d(-50%, 0, 0) scaleX(1)}.two-cols{display:table;width:100%}.two-cols .col{display:table-cell;width:50%;vertical-align:top}h1{font-size:5em}h2{font-size:3em;margin-bottom:.25em}h3{font-size:2em}.text-and-image{position:relative;height:100%;min-height:250px}.text-and-image .mobile-image{display:none}.text-and-image .image-wrapper{position:absolute;width:50%;top:0px;display:block;height:100%;-webkit-transform:scale(1.1);-ms-transform:scale(1.1);transform:scale(1.1);z-index:0}.text-and-image .image-wrapper .image-container{display:block;position:absolute;height:100%;width:100%;top:0px;left:0px;background-size:contain;background-position:center center}.text-and-image .text-wrapper{display:block;z-index:1;position:relative}.text-and-image.text-left .image-wrapper{left:50%;-webkit-transform:translate3d(0, 0, 0) scale(1);transform:translate3d(0, 0, 0) scale(1)}.text-and-image.text-left .text-wrapper{width:50%;padding:2em 5% 2em 0}.text-and-image.text-right .image-wrapper{left:0%;-webkit-transform:translate3d(0, 0, 0) scale(1);transform:translate3d(0, 0, 0) scale(1)}.text-and-image.text-right .text-wrapper{margin-left:50%;width:50%;padding:2em 5% 2em 5%}.text-and-image.image-33-percent .image-wrapper{width:33%}.text-and-image.image-33-percent.text-left .image-wrapper{left:67%;-webkit-transform:translate3d(0, 0, 0) scale(1);transform:translate3d(0, 0, 0) scale(1)}.text-and-image.image-33-percent.text-left .text-wrapper{width:67%}.text-and-image.image-33-percent.text-right .image-wrapper{left:0%;-webkit-transform:translate3d(0, 0, 0) scale(1);transform:translate3d(0, 0, 0) scale(1)}.text-and-image.image-33-percent.text-right .text-wrapper{margin-left:33%;width:67%}}

/*# sourceMappingURL=.sourcemaps/dxp.min.css.map */
